Understanding is a science. Ken Goodman's research isn't the laboratory rats-and-pigeon kind, however. He uses the miscues of real readers reading real texts to inform how about how language works and what strategies developing and fluent readers use. His purpose in this book is to examine that knowledge with teachers so they can understand more precisely what it is their students are learning to do and how best to help them. Goodman's sensible, straightforward look at how reading works as a process makes this book, like his earlier Phonics Phacts, a must for every teacher and interested parent.
